PHP 關鍵字 use 的使用方法

2021-08-28 03:37:22 字數 531 閱讀 7693

比方說建三個檔案。

- 第乙個檔案 a.php,裡邊有兩個類,命名空間是 a\b\c;

<?php

namespace a\b\c;

function get_info()

}class c

}

- 第二個檔案 b.php 命名空間 a\b\d;

<?php

namespace a\b\d;

function get_info()

}

比方說我們現在想例項化a.php裡的類,該怎麼實現呢?

首先要包含這個檔案 require_once(『a.php』);

注意:use不等於require_once或者include,use的前提是已經把檔案包含進當前檔案。

順便提一句,在mvc模式中,類名和檔名是相同的,所以use的時候會讓不了解的人以為use後面跟的是檔名,我之前就這麼以為的。其實use的還是類名。

【**感謝博主的總結 ^ ^

php 中use關鍵字的用法

use最常用在給類取別名 use還可以用在閉包函式中,如下 php view plain copy function test b test b world 結果是hellohello 當執行test函式,test函式返回閉包函式,閉包函式中的use中的變數為test函式中的 a變數,當執行閉包函式...

js 關鍵字 in 的使用方法

1.for.in 宣告用於對陣列或者物件的屬性進行迴圈 迭代操作。對於陣列,迭代出來的是陣列元素,對於物件,迭代出來的是物件的屬性 var x var mycars new array mycars 0 saab mycars 1 volvo mycars 2 bmw for x in mycars...

js 關鍵字 in 的使用方法

1.for.in 宣告用於對陣列或者物件的屬性進行迴圈 迭代操作。對於陣列,迭代出來的是陣列元素,對於物件,迭代出來的是物件的屬性 var x var mycars new array mycars 0 saab mycars 1 volvo mycars 2 bmw for x in mycars...